社区
UNIX文化
帖子详情
在vim中,怎样搜索光标所在的字符串
zhouxiangbai
2018-03-06 11:23:56
在vim中,怎样搜索光标所在的字符串?
首先,是如何获取光标所在的字符串,然后,使用vimgrep或grep,指定搜索目录进行搜索,接着,使用copen命令将搜索结果显示在quickfix窗口。
上面这一系列操作,怎样使用快捷键映射来实现?
...全文
2344
2
打赏
收藏
在vim中,怎样搜索光标所在的字符串
在vim中,怎样搜索光标所在的字符串? 首先,是如何获取光标所在的字符串,然后,使用vimgrep或grep,指定搜索目录进行搜索,接着,使用copen命令将搜索结果显示在quickfix窗口。 上面这一系列操作,怎样使用快捷键映射来实现?
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
2 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
文虫并雕
2018-07-24
打赏
举报
回复
1
tab tab shift+* n n n 明白?
vim
编辑器的用法
一、
vim
的三种模式以及作用 命令模式:控制
光标
移动,可对文本进行删除、复制、粘贴 末行模式:保存、推出与设置编辑环境 编辑模式:正常的文本录入 二、命令模式常用快捷键 dd 删除(剪切)
光标
所在的整行 ndd n为数字,删除(剪切)从
光标
处开始的n行 dG 删除
光标
所在行到文件末尾内容 D 删除
光标
所在处到尾行内容 yy 复制
光标
所在的整行 nyy n为数字,复制从
光标
处开始的n行 p 将之前删除(dd)或者复制(yy)过的粘贴到
光标
后 /
字符串
在文本
中
从上至下
搜索
该
字符串
?
字符串
在文本
中
从上至下
搜索
该
字符串
n 在
搜索
字
VI/
VIM
下如何
搜索
字符串
1.命令模式下,输入:/
字符串
比如
搜索
user, 输入/user 按下回车之后,可以看到
vim
已经把
光标
移动到该字符处和高亮了匹配的
字符串
2.查看下一个匹配,按下n(小写n) 3.跳转到上一个匹配,按下N(大写N) 4.
搜索
后,我们打开别的文件,发现也被高亮了,怎么关闭高亮? 命令模式下,输入:nohlsearch 也可以:setnohlsearch;当然,可以简写,noh或者set noh。 ...
vi/
vim
下如何
搜索
字符串
1. 命令模式下,输入:/
字符串
比如
搜索
user, 输入/user 按下回车之后,可以看到
vim
已经把
光标
移动到该字符处和高亮了匹配的
字符串
2. 查看下一个匹配,按下n(小写n) 3. 跳转到上一个匹配,按下N(大写N) 4.
搜索
后,我们打开别的文件,发现也被高亮了,怎么关闭高亮? 命令模式下,输入:n
Linux在
vim
中
查找指定
字符串
Linux在
vim
中
查找指定
字符串
一般地 首先在
vim
中
按一下 esc 键 然后输入命令: 自当前
光标
位置向上
搜索
: /pattern enter 要自当前
光标
位置向下
搜索
: ?pattern Enter 其
中
,pattern 表示要
搜索
的特定字符序列。 如果 vi 找到了 place,它将把
光标
定位在 p 处。要
搜索
place 的其他匹配,请按 n 或 N: **其
中
n表示继续朝同一方向
搜索
place。
Vim
搜索
(查找代码、
字符串
等)
搜索
(查找) #
搜索
模式 / # 前向
搜索
匹配 ? # 反向
搜索
匹配 # 移动定位 n # 跳到下一个匹配的位置 N # 跳到上一个匹配的位置 * # 对
光标
当前所在的完整单词进行前向
搜索
匹配 # # 对
光标
当前所在的完整单词进行后向
搜索
匹配 g* # 前向
搜索
光标
当前所在单词 g# # 反向
搜索
光标
当前所在单词
搜索
时字母大小写情况设置# 设置
vim
rc文件 # 当输入的
搜索
词全部是小写时,忽略大小写;
搜索
词至少有一个大写字母时,进行大小写匹配
搜索
set ignorecase
UNIX文化
2,161
社区成员
4,355
社区内容
发帖
与我相关
我的任务
UNIX文化
Linux/Unix社区 UNIX文化
复制链接
扫一扫
分享
社区描述
Linux/Unix社区 UNIX文化
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章